Python中的财富图

阅读KZKG ^ Gaara的有关“财富”的文章时,我想起了我前一段时间编写的Python脚本,以便可以在窗口中看到来自“财富”的消息。

您需要安装python(显然),并带有gtk和gobject的库:pygtk,pygobject (在Ubuntu及其衍生版本中,安装python-gtk2和python-gobject软件包)

要使用它,必须将代码复制到纯文本文件中,例如,名称为fortune_gtk.py。 它可以从终端运行,位于保存文件并运行的目录中:

python fortune_gtk.py

或授予它执行权限并像任何应用程序一样启动它。 (例如,双击)

窗口视图与财富

窗口视图与财富

该脚本一个接一个地显示不同的消息,并在关闭窗口时结束。

根据文本的长度,窗口的大小和消息的持续时间会有所变化,以实现更好的可视化效果。 另外,如果您单击窗口,则将复制文本,并将其粘贴到文本编辑器中。

考虑到字体是等距的,因此不会错位。

下面的代码。 好好享受!!

(下载时,以名称fortune_gtk.py保存)

PS:我不是程序员,只是业余爱好者。 显…:-)


发表您的评论

您的电子邮件地址将不会被发表。 必填字段标有 *

*

*

  1. 负责数据:MiguelÁngelGatón
  2. 数据用途:控制垃圾邮件,注释管理。
  3. 合法性:您的同意
  4. 数据通讯:除非有法律义务,否则不会将数据传达给第三方。
  5. 数据存储:Occentus Networks(EU)托管的数据库
  6. 权利:您可以随时限制,恢复和删除您的信息。

  1.   KZKG ^ Gaara

    感谢您的贡献contribution

    1.    鲁本·古努

      相反,感谢您的工作!

  2.   鲁本·古努

    如果他们看到消息不适合窗口显示,则表明系统显示的字母很大。 您可以通过增加窗口的大小来进行更正。 怎么样? 在代码中...
    哪里说:
    self.factor = 2
    这意味着0.2->窗口大小是屏幕的20%
    纠正口味的因素。 例如,以30%的比例将是:
    self.factor = 3
    保存文件并完成!

  3.   可怜的taku

    我在debian 8中提供了该应用程序,但是它不能很好地工作,但是感谢代码,在几年后,当我是c ++ jedi并且到达python时,它将是一个很好的教学材料

    1.    鲁本·古努

      你怎么了?